OTOKAR has announced at the Public Disclosure Platform (KAP) that it will follow Turkish Undersecreteriat for Defence Industry's (SSM's) tender procedures regarding Altay main battle tank. The company used to have exclusive right to submit its offer as the manufacturer of the tank's prototype. OTOKAR, who has sent its best and last offer in 2016, said it has received a document from SSM saying that the offer had been evaluated in terms of managerial, financial and technical aspects however not found favorable due to disagreement on the contract clauses, especially the ones regarding the price.Â
According to the information obtained by C4Defence, the subcontractors constitute 70 percent of the price on OTOKAR's offer. Subcontractors, on the other hand, are chosen by the undersecreteriat.
